GATA'S History

Whichever path you take in aviation, it is essential to start with the right information, that's what GATA stands for.

Ghana Civil Aviation Authority (G.C.A.A) part of its Corporate Strategy established GATA in 2008 as a center of excellence in Aviation knowledge acquisition. it has the state-of-the-Art facilities and systems to provide aviation training in West Africa and beyond.

GATA, using qualified instructors has trained personnel from Liberia, Nigeria, Gambia, Sao Tome etc in Air Traffic Control courses.

It has also trained Aviation Inspectors and other Safety Regulation Personnel in collaboration with the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A), USAInternational Civil Aviation Organization (ICAO) and The Banjul Accord Group Aviation Safety Oversight Organization (BAGASOO).

GATA is a convenient place to host aviation related Local, International Conferences, Seminars, Workshops, Meetings, Fairs etc.

GATA was established in 2008 under the Ghana Civil Aviation Sector Upgrade Project (GCASUP) situated at the location of the old air traffic control school, which has been in existence since the late 50s with the mandate to train air traffic control assistants for the then civil aviation department. The old building was remodeled into a modern facility and has a state-of-the-art simulator to train Air traffic controllers for Ghana and the sub-region. GATA as an academy came into operation in 2009 and has since organized various Local and International Aviation courses which has since generated considerable interest among countries in the West African Sub-Region and beyond.
